The Storm - during and after!
In the afternoon, all sunshine, blue skies and calm water was lost to a sudden storm which came in from the north. Boaters were caught by surprise as thunder and lightening brought rain and wind.
Once the storm was done, blue skies resumed and a rainbow blessed the skies over Manchaug Pond.

A Sacred Sunday Sunset!
While other areas suffered thunderstorms, no rain fell on Manchaug Pond making for a beautiful Sunday on the lake. A fishing tournament started the day, but it was the campers that later came out in droves to boat Manchaug Pond.

After the storm - Pollen!
The tornado/thunderstorms split going north and south of us here on Manchaug Pond with just little rain received. But now pollen is seen dusting the water.
